Ligasure Precise vs. conventional diathermy for Milligan-Morgan hemorrhoidectomy: a prospective, randomised, multicenter trial. Dis Colon Rectum 2008; 51: 514-519.

Published: 1st January 2008

Authors: Altomare DF, Milito G, Andreoli R, Arcana F, Tricomi N, Salafia C et al. et al.

Conclusion

A total of 273 procedures were included. There were no differences between the methods in terms of early or late complications. The Ligasure device reduced postoperative pain at 12h after defaecation (P<0.01) and speeded return to normal activity.
